The 1971-72 Men's Basketball Team was the first in Lincoln history to win the MIAA regular season championship, as the Blue Tigers went 22-6 overall and 11-1 in conference play. Led by first year head coach Don Corbett, the 1971-72 squad at one point put together a 13-game winning streak as LU was victorious in 17 of its final 18 regular season games. Led by MIAA Player of the Year LaMonte Pruitt and James Hampton, who led the league with 13.0 rebounds per game, the 1971-72 Blue Tigers ended up making the NCAA tournament, with Pruitt earning NCAA Regional All-Tournament honors.
